Transferable diamond tapes for decoupling diamond growth from metal protection
This paper introduces a transferable diamond tape strategy that decouples diamond growth from metal substrates by growing polycrystalline diamond on a releasable TiO₂ nanorod-engineered silicon template and attaching it to Ti6Al4V via a TiO₂ sol-gel adhesive, thereby creating a hierarchical, wear- and corrosion-resistant protective layer that reduces wear rates by four orders of magnitude and significantly lowers corrosion current density.
